Trust, helmed by Danny Boyle (Trainspotting, Slumdog Millionare) and written by Simon Beaufoy (Slumdog Millionaire, 127 hours) depicts the 1973 kidnapping of John Paul Getty III and the events surrounding the Getty family during the time. The events was last depicted in 2017’s All the money in the world, and I’d say this mini series depicts the real world events a lot more interesting, and more enjoyable.
